New Technologies in Athletics
The field of sports technology is rapidly evolving, driven by innovations that enhance sports performance and improve the spectator experience. Portable devices, such as smartwatches and fitness trackers, are now common among players and sports enthusiasts alike. These devices gather valuable data on measurements such as heart rate, distance traveled, and rest, enabling sportspeople to monitor their performance and recovery more effectively. This data-focused approach allows coaches and trainers to tailor training programs to personalized needs, maximizing the capabilities of each player.
Another significant advancement is the integration of AI and machine learning in athletic analytics. Teams are increasingly using AI to analyze match results, player performance, and league standings with unprecedented accuracy. These technologies can process vast amounts of data in real time, providing insights that were previously inaccessible. Coaches can make informed decisions during games, adjust strategies based on live statistics, and spot areas for development in their players’ skills. This analytical capability enhances competitive strategies and truly changes the dynamics of training and game day execution.
Virtual reality and AR are also creating their impact in the sports industry. Athletes are using VR for training simulations that simulate game scenarios, allowing them to train decision-making and reactions without bodily strain. Meanwhile, AR is transforming how fans engage with athletics, offering interactive experiences during real-time events. By superimposing statistics or player information onto the physical view, fans can derive deeper insights into the game, improving their enjoyment and understanding. These technologies are shaping the future of athletic performance and creating new avenues for spectator interaction.
Influence on Performance Analysis
The incorporation of advanced technology in athletic performance analysis has transformed how athletes and coaches evaluate and improve performance. Wearable devices, such as GPS trackers and heart rate monitors, provide accurate data on an individual’s physical output during workouts and competitions. This immediate data allows for comprehensive insights into an individual’s speed, stamina, and general physical condition, enabling more tailored training programs that cater to specific requirements and areas for growth.
Video analysis tools have also changed performance analysis by providing in-depth breakdowns of player movements and team strategies. Trainers can now use high-speed cameras and software to evaluate techniques, placement, and decision-making in a way that was formerly impossible. Through these graphic tools, athletes can receive immediate feedback, helping them to refine their abilities and enhance their in-game performance based on objective data rather than subjective opinions.
Additionally, machine learning and AI are beginning to take on a crucial role in analyzing vast amounts of athletic data. These technologies can detect trends and forecast outcomes, offering strategic insights that can lead to improved choices during games. As these developments continue to advance, they promise to enhance not only personal athlete performance but also overall group efficiency, driving the next phase of sports towards increasingly analytical strategies.
